Race promoter Singapore GP Pte Ltd is seeking dynamic individuals to fill the position of Manager / Assistant Zone Manager in Retail Merchandise Operations.
You are responsible for overseeing the retail operations of 5 designated booths during the event. This role involves coordinating stock movement, managing logistics, ensuring compliance with event SOPs, and leading the retail team members to ensure smooth daily execution.
Key Responsibilities:
Logistics Planning & Coordination
- Plan, coordinate, and execute end-to-end retail logistics from warehouse to event site
- Manage delivery schedules, load-in/load-out timelines, and venue access requirements
Sales Support & Demand Management
- Monitor real-time sell-through performance and communicate stock risks or opportunities
Team Leadership & Coordination
- Lead and brief retail booth staff on stock handling and logistics processes
- Act as the primary point of contact for all logistics and stock-related matters at the booth
- Train team members on inventory accuracy, handling standards, and operational discipline
Key Requirements:
- Minimally a Diploma/Degree in Business, Supply Chain, Retail Management or related fields.
- At least 2 to 5 years of experience in e-commerce operations, retail operations, or merchandising (event experience is an advantage).
- Ability to manage high-volume and fast paced operations, especially during event cycles.
- Strong organisational, leadership, and stakeholder management skills.
- Proficient in inventory systems, e-commerce platforms, and logistics coordination.
- Able and willing to work long hours, including evenings and weekends.
